Thanks to recent advances in sensors, communication and satellite technology, data storage, processing and networking capabilities, satellite image acquisition and mining are now on the rise. In turn, satellite images play a vital role in providing essential geographical information. Highly accurate automatic classification and decision support systems can facilitate the efforts of data analysts, reduce human error, and allow the rapid and rigorous analysis of land use and land cover information. Integrating Machine Learning (ML) technology with the human visual psychometric can help meet geologists’ demands for more efficient and higher-quality classification in real time. This book introduces readers to key concepts, methods and models for satellite image analysis; highlights state-of-the-art classification and clustering techniques; discusses recent developments and remaining challenges; and addresses various applications, making it a valuable asset for engineers, data analysts and researchers in the fields of geographic information systems and remote sensing engineering.

This book covers the state-of-art image classification methods for discrimination of earth objects from remote sensing satellite data with an emphasis on fuzzy machine learning and deep learning algorithms. Both types of algorithms are described in such details that these can be implemented directly for thematic mapping of multiple-class or specific-class landcover from multispectral optical remote sensing data. These algorithms along with multi-date, multi-sensor remote sensing are capable to monitor specific stage (for e.g., phenology of growing crop) of a particular class also included. With these capabilities fuzzy machine learning algorithms have strong applications in areas like crop insurance, forest fire mapping, stubble burning, post disaster damage mapping etc. It also provides details about the temporal indices database using proposed Class Based Sensor Independent (CBSI) approach supported by practical examples. As well, this book addresses other related algorithms based on distance, kernel based as well as spatial information through Markov Random Field (MRF)/Local convolution methods to handle mixed pixels, non-linearity and noisy pixels. Further, this book covers about techniques for quantiative assessment of soft classified fraction outputs from soft classification and supported by in-house developed tool called sub-pixel multi-spectral image classifier (SMIC). It is aimed at graduate, postgraduate, research scholars and working professionals of different branches such as Geoinformation sciences, Geography, Electrical, Electronics and Computer Sciences etc., working in the fields of earth observation and satellite image processing. Learning algorithms discussed in this book may also be useful in other related fields, for example, in medical imaging. Overall, this book aims to: exclusive focus on using large range of fuzzy classification algorithms for remote sensing images; discuss ANN, CNN, RNN, and hybrid learning classifiers application on remote sensing images; describe sub-pixel multi-spectral image classifier tool (SMIC) to support discussed fuzzy and learning algorithms; explain how to assess soft classified outputs as fraction images using fuzzy error matrix (FERM) and its advance versions with FERM tool, Entropy, Correlation Coefficient, Root Mean Square Error and Receiver Operating Characteristic (ROC) methods and; combines explanation of the algorithms with case studies and practical applications.

Satellite image processing is crucial in detecting vegetation, clouds, and other atmospheric applications. Due to sensor limitations and pre-processing, remotely sensed satellite images may have interpretability concerns as to specific portions of the image, making it hard to recognise patterns or objects and posing the risk of losing minute details in the image. Existing imaging processors and optical components are expensive to counterfeit, have interpretability issues, and are not necessarily viable in real applications. This book exploits the usage of deep learning (DL) components in feature extraction to boost the minute details of images and their classification implications to tackle such problems. It shows the importance of super-resolution in improving the spatial details of images and aiding digital aerial photography in pan-sharpening, detecting signatures correctly, and making precise decisions with decision-making tools.

With the recent advances in remote sensing technologies for Earth observation, many different remote sensors are collecting data with distinctive properties. The obtained data are so large and complex that analyzing them manually becomes impractical or even impossible. Therefore, understanding remote sensing images effectively, in connection with physics, has been the primary concern of the remote sensing research community in recent years. For this purpose, machine learning is thought to be a promising technique because it can make the system learn to improve itself. With this distinctive characteristic, the algorithms will be more adaptive, automatic, and intelligent. This book introduces some of the most challenging issues of machine learning in the field of remote sensing, and the latest advanced technologies developed for different applications. It integrates with multi-source/multi-temporal/multi-scale data, and mainly focuses on learning to understand remote sensing images. Particularly, it presents many more effective techniques based on the popular concepts of deep learning and big data to reach new heights of data understanding. Through reporting recent advances in the machine learning approaches towards analyzing and understanding remote sensing images, this book can help readers become more familiar with knowledge frontier and foster an increased interest in this field.

The rapid growth of the world population has resulted in an exponential expansion of both urban and agricultural areas. Identifying and managing such earthly changes in an automatic way poses a worth-addressing challenge, in which remote sensing technology can have a fundamental role to answer—at least partially—such demands. The recent advent of cutting-edge processing facilities has fostered the adoption of deep learning architectures owing to their generalization capabilities. In this respect, it seems evident that the pace of deep learning in the remote sensing domain remains somewhat lagging behind that of its computer vision counterpart. This is due to the scarce availability of ground truth information in comparison with other computer vision domains. In this book, we aim at advancing the state of the art in linking deep learning methodologies with remote sensing image processing by collecting 20 contributions from different worldwide scientists and laboratories. The book presents a wide range of methodological advancements in the deep learning field that come with different applications in the remote sensing landscape such as wildfire and postdisaster damage detection, urban forest mapping, vine disease and pavement marking detection, desert road mapping, road and building outline extraction, vehicle and vessel detection, water identification, and text-to-image matching.
